Mniotype anilis sylvatica (Bellier, 1861)
(Figs 42, 80, 116)
Mamestra sylvatica Bellier, 1861, Annales de la Société Entomologique de France (4) 1: 29, pl. 2, fig. 11 (Type locality: Corsica).
Synonymy: Crino sylvatica var. bellieri Schawerda, 1943 (Type locality: Corsica).

Diagnosis. Wingspan 45–47 mm. Head, thorax and abdomen dark blackish grey. Ground colour of forewing dark blackish grey. Wing pattern similar to that of the nominotypical subspecies. Hindwing dark brownish grey. The male genitalia (Fig. 80) very close to M. anilis anilis, but uncus slightly longer and juxta somewhat narrower. The female genitalia (Fig. 116) have no diagnostic features with regard to M. anilis anilis .
Distribution. Corsica and Sardinia.
